Summary
The effect of airflow blockage and guide technology on energy saving in spiral quick-freezers was investigated by simulating and analysing the airflow field and measuring the velocity distribution in the freezing zone for different designs. The k-epsilon turbulence model was used. The velocities and temperatures of the air in the freezing zone for different designs of airflow blockage and guide boards were measured. The study shows that the airflow pattern plays a key role on energy efficiency, freezing time, and production rate. In the case study, through the optimization of the airflow blocking boards and the guide boards, the average air velocity in the freezing zone was enhanced 2.5-2.7 times compared with the original design. Correspondingly, for bean curds in a stationary condition, the freezing time would be shortened by 78-85%, energy efficiency and the production rate would be increased by approximately 18-28%.
